What is the fee charged by retailers for accepting credit cards?

Retailers will rarely charge a fee for accepting payment from you the customer, they accept fees charged by credit card networks and processors, called a discount rate. The fees are based on Interchange categories that vary by card type, with debit cards being the least costly and rewards and business cards being among the highest.

Can you explain how the APR for credit cards is calculated and what factors can affect it?

The APR for credit cards is calculated by considering the interest rate and any additional fees charged by the credit card company. Factors that can affect the APR include the cardholder's credit score, the current market interest rates, and the type of credit card being used.
